🔨 Integrasjoner
PostgreSQL i Illa er en databaseintegrasjon som lar deg koble til og samhandle med en PostgreSQL database. PostgreSQL er et populært relasjonssystem for basestasjon med åpen kildekode, som er kjent for dets stabilitet, pålitelighet og kraftige funksjoner.
Med PostgreSQL integrasjon i Illa kan du spørre, innsette, oppdatere og slette data fra en PostgreSQL database ved å bruke SQL-kommandoer. Du kan også opprette egendefinerte SQL-spørringer og kjøre dem i Illa aksjon. Dette gjør det enkelt å bygge data-drevne programmer og dashbord som viser sanntidsdata fra en PostgreSQL database.
Det er to måter å lage en ressurs i Illa etter å ha logget på din Illa-konto.
Logg deg på din Illa konto, velg **Ressurser**
på toppen av siden, og klikk **Opprett ny
-knappen.
Velg PostgreSQL
fra databaselisten.
Koble til databasen med de nødvendige parametrene beskrevet i “Tilkoblingsinnstillinger” nedenfor.
Klikk **Test oppkobling**
for å se om vi har lykkes i å koble til databasen. Hvis ja, klikk Lagre ressurser
, eller dobbeltsjekk vertsnavn, port, brukernavn og passord er riktig.
Etter oppretting av en ressurs, vil den klare PostgreSQL vises som vist.
Logg deg på din Illa konto, opprett et prosjekt i Illa Builder på **
siden, og naviger til Handlingslisten
nederst på siden. Klikk **new**
, og velg PostgreSQL
fra databaselisten. Deretter kan du koble til databasen med nødvendige parametere beskrevet i “Tilkoblingsinnstillinger” nedenfor.
Klikk **Test oppkobling**
for å se om vi har lykkes i å koble til databasen. Hvis ja, klikk Lagre ressurser
, eller dobbeltsjekk vertsnavn, port, brukernavn og passord er riktig.
Her må vi skaffe informasjon for å koble til PostgreSQL databasen.
Egenskaper | Påkrevd | Beskrivelse |
---|---|---|
Navn | obligatorisk | Navnet på ressursen når det skapes handlinger i ILLA. |
Hostname | obligatorisk | URL-adressen eller IP-adressen for databasen din |
Port | obligatorisk | Tjenerens portnummer som du bør bruke til å koble til. Hvis du ikke angir en port, er standard port ‘5432’. |
Databasen | obligatorisk | Navnet på databasen |
Brukernavn | obligatorisk | brukernavnet du vil bruke når du logger inn på PostgreSQL serveren. |
Passord | obligatorisk | Bruk dette passordet for godkjenning. |
SSL valg | valgfritt | avgjør hvor høyt en sikker SSL-TCP/IP-tilkobling prioriteres ved forhandlinger med tjeneren. |
Vi har opprettet en PostgreSQL ressurs, vi kan legge til handlingen ved å velge PostgreSQL fra handlingslisten og velge Create action
knappen.
Nå har vi lagt til PostgreSQL serveren som en handling til vår byggeside.
Egenskaper | Beskrivelse |
---|---|
SQL spørring | SQL-kommandoer å hente (velg), innstilt, oppdatere, slette data fra database |
Transformator | transformerer data til stilen du ønsker å bruke JavaScript |
Eksempel bruk:
SELECT * FROM users ORDER BY lastname;
INSERT INTO users
(firstname, lastname, email)
VALUES
(
{{ NewUser.data.firstNameInput }},
{{ NewUser.data.lastNameInput }},
{{ NewUser.data.emailInput }}
);
UPDATE users
SET firstname = '{{form1.updatedProfile.first}}'
WHERE id = {{ form1.updatedProfile.uid}};
DELETE FROM users WHERE id = {{ form1.updatedProfile.uid }};